Minn. R. agency 171, ch. 7421, pt. 7421.0900 - TESTING REQUIRED AFTER CDL DOWNGRADE
A driver applicant for a commercial driver's license whose license has been downgraded to a class D license for more than one year must pass applicable required knowledge tests and a road test administered by the commissioner.
A driver applicant must pass all the knowledge tests required for the class of license and endorsements required for the vehicle that the driver applicant expects to operate.
